Q: Is 22,688,130 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 22,688,130 is a composite number.

Why is 22,688,130 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 22,688,130 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 5 6 10 15 30 756,271 1,512,542 2,268,813 3,781,355 4,537,626 7,562,710 11,344,065 and 22,688,130, with no remainder.

Since 22,688,130 cannot be divided by just 1 and 22,688,130, it is a composite number.
